CHARACTER COUNTS AT ELIZABETH IDE

How did we celebrate good Citizenship at Elizabeth Ide?

We adopted a Rainforest!


The response to the Adopt-A-Rainforest coin donation was tremendous! While collecting the coins over a 2-week period, WE RAISED $390.28 The students, parents, and teachers at Elizabeth Ide really contributed to raising the awareness about the importance of rainforests. Our donation will be used for a conservation project in either Belize, Brazil, Colombia, Ecuador, El Salvador, Honduras, or Nicaragua. We have asked the Rainforest Alliance to allocate our donation to the neediest project. A big thank you to Mrs. Tran for organizing this fundraiser.

We learned how to respect animals in nature!

The second graders were treated to an Owl assembly hosted by the Willowbrook Wildlife Center in Glen Ellyn, donated by Mr. Hansen and organized by the PTO. Students learned how important owls are to the environment and many other fascinating facts.
